Summary

The WSJ piece analyzes a tight labor market for white-collar roles, noting that candidates are increasingly paying recruiters to secure opportunities. It discusses rising hiring costs, prolonged time-to-fill, and questions the efficiency of traditional recruiting, hinting at opportunities for automation and AI-enabled sourcing.
